About us
Formed in 2014, Tendermint is the creator of Cosmos, an ecosystem of interoperable blockchains. We are a software engineering company that focuses on the Cosmos SDK and Starport, state-of-the-art frameworks for blockchain development. Over USD 100 billion worth of digital assets is secured by the 200+ blockchains built with the Cosmos SDK.
We’re passionate, self-driven industry leaders whose vision is to empower people to create a more transparent and accountable world through open, distributed, and interoperable networks. We believe that the technology we're building will have a major positive impact on how humans connect and coordinate globally. What does a recruiter in web3 do? Recruiters in the web3 space are responsible for identifying, attracting, and hiring top talent for web3-related organizations
This typically involves sourcing and screening candidates, conducting interviews, negotiating offers, and building and maintaining relationships with potential candidates and industry professionals
Recruiters in the web3 space also need to have a deep understanding of web3 technologies and the ability to assess technical skills and fit for various roles
